1099's must be postmarked by Jan 31 according to the US tax codes. This rerely happens. US webmasters you need to keep track of your own payments. Do not rely on 1099s. I use around 40-50 sponsors and have gottenmaybe 4 1099s. Where the other ones are no clue but i will still report my earnings even if i dont get one. YOu still need to report overseas sponsors as well. The US goverent knows what you put in your checking/savings account and if you report say 70k and deposite 140k well you are simply gonna get flagged for a audit then be prepapred to explain where that other 70k came from. simple and short YOU need to keep track of your earnings not rely on 1099s.

Foreign sponsors do not send out 1099's as they do not pay US taxes and therefor see no reason to burden themselves with that kind of shit.
As was stated before, make sure your income in the checking account matches what you report. When you get audited they check your last three bank statements to get an idea of what is going on... Of course this doesn't help you when you are growing... Try telling them that you made much less in Jan of last year to Dec of last year than you currently are this year and they will just laugh at you... |
